Housed in a historic building in the centre of old Lausanne, the MUDAC museum has welcomed ‘Pop-Up: design entre dimensions’ (on show until March 3rd, 2013). The small spaces of the building allow visitors to experience this exhibit on a more intimate level, guided through different moods ranging from abstraction to narration, from technology to textile, and from heavy metal and lace to chocolate…

Pop-Up’s second edition includes new elements such as an especially-commissioned mirror by Studio Job, the enchanting ‘Danseuses’ by Atelier Oï, fur interventions in the public sphere by Neozoon and a site-specific paper cut-out installation by Andrea Mastrovito. The opening was celebrated by live performances by Laurens Manders and Niels Meuleman.
